Can you recommend some 1920s fiction books for beginners?

2 answers
2024-12-10 14:52

For beginners, 'The Great Gatsby' is a great choice. It's not too long and has a really engaging story about Jay Gatsby's pursuit of Daisy Buchanan, set against the backdrop of the wealthy in the 1920s. Another good one is 'Mrs. Dalloway'. It's easy to follow in terms of the basic plot, which is about a day in the life of Clarissa Dalloway, and it gives a good sense of the social and cultural atmosphere of the time.

Can you recommend Alan Bradley's Fantastic Fiction books?

3 answers
2024-12-09 06:11

Sure. 'I Am Half - Sick of Shadows' by Alan Bradley is great. It's part of the Flavia de Luce series. Flavia gets involved in solving a mystery during a movie - making at her family's crumbling estate.
